登录linux服务器需要什么端口

不及物动词 其他 50

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    登录Linux服务器需要使用SSH协议进行远程连接,而SSH协议默认使用22号端口。

    SSH是Secure Shell的缩写,它提供了一种通过网络对远程主机进行加密的安全通信方式。通过SSH,用户可以在不同的主机之间建立起加密的连接,并且可以在远程主机上执行命令、传输文件等操作。

    当我们使用SSH连接Linux服务器时,需要确保本地和目标主机上的SSH服务都是打开并正常运行的。一般情况下,大多数Linux服务器都会默认安装并启动SSH服务。如果SSH服务未安装或未启动,我们需要先安装并启动SSH服务。

    在Linux服务器上,可以使用以下命令检查SSH服务是否已安装和运行:

    service sshd status
    

    如果SSH服务未安装,可以使用以下命令安装:

    yum install openssh-server   # 适用于基于Red Hat系列的系统,如CentOS
    apt-get install openssh-server   # 适用于基于Debian系列的系统,如Ubuntu
    

    安装完成后,可以使用以下命令启动SSH服务:

    service sshd start
    

    默认情况下,SSH服务会监听在22号端口。所以,在使用SSH连接Linux服务器时,我们需要确保22号端口是打开的,并且可以从外部网络访问。如果服务器上有防火墙的话,需要相应地配置防火墙规则,允许SSH连接通过22号端口。

    总结起来,登录Linux服务器需要使用SSH协议进行远程连接,而SSH协议默认使用22号端口。确保目标主机上已安装并启动SSH服务,并确保22号端口是打开的并可以从外部网络访问。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    登录Linux服务器通常使用SSH协议进行远程登录。默认情况下,SSH使用22号端口进行连接。因此,要登录Linux服务器,需要确保目标服务器的22号端口是开放的。

    除了SSH协议之外,还有其他一些端口也可能用于登录Linux服务器,如Telnet(23号端口)或RDP(远程桌面协议,3389号端口)。然而,这些协议通常不推荐使用,因为它们的安全性很低,容易受到攻击。

    以下是一些关于Linux服务器登录端口的重要信息:

    1. SSH默认端口:SSH默认使用22号端口进行连接。如果管理员在服务器上进行了端口转发设置,可能会使用其他端口号。在使用SSH登录服务器时,要确保目标服务器的SSH端口是开放的,并且防火墙不会阻止连接。

    2. 防火墙和端口:许多Linux服务器默认启用防火墙,例如iptables或firewalld。要登录服务器,需要在防火墙上配置允许SSH连接的规则。在iptables中,可以使用以下命令打开22号端口:

    sudo iptables -A INPUT -p tcp --dport 22 -j ACCEPT
    

    在firewalld中,可以使用以下命令打开22号端口:

    sudo firewall-cmd --permanent --add-port=22/tcp
    sudo firewall-cmd --reload
    
    1. 配置SSH端口:如果管理员决定更改SSH默认端口,可以通过修改SSH配置文件来实现。SSH配置文件通常位于/etc/ssh/sshd_config。在该文件中,可以找到Port关键字,并将其设置为所需的端口。修改后,要重启SSH服务以使更改生效。

    2. 其他登录协议端口:除了SSH,某些管理员可能选择使用其他协议进行登录,如Telnet或RDP。然而,这些协议不够安全,不推荐使用。如果管理员使用这些协议,请确保相应的端口开放,并采取额外的安全措施(如使用SSH隧道)来保护连接。

    3. 端口扫描和安全性:为了确保服务器安全,管理员应该定期进行端口扫描,以查找未经授权的开放端口。此外,强烈建议使用强密码和公钥认证来加强登录安全性,并禁用root用户直接登录服务器。还可以考虑使用基于密钥的双因素认证来提高登录的安全性。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要登录到Linux服务器,需要使用SSH(Secure Shell)协议。SSH协议默认使用22号端口来进行连接。因此,要登录Linux服务器,需要确保22号端口是开放的并且没有被防火墙阻止。

    以下是登录Linux服务器的详细步骤:

    1. 获取服务器的IP地址:首先要知道要登录的Linux服务器的IP地址。

    2. 打开终端或命令提示符:在本地计算机上打开终端(Linux、macOS)或命令提示符(Windows)。

    3. 输入SSH命令:在终端或命令提示符中,输入以下命令来连接到Linux服务器:

      ssh username@IP地址
      

      其中,username是登录Linux服务器的用户名,IP地址是Linux服务器的IP地址。

      例如,如果要以用户名"admin"连接到IP地址为192.168.0.1的Linux服务器,那么命令应该是:

      ssh admin@192.168.0.1
      
    4. 输入密码:如果是第一次使用该服务器的话,会提示你确认服务器的指纹信息并输入密码。输入正确的密码后,按下回车键。

      需要注意的是,在输入密码时,终端或命令提示符不会显示任何反馈,如星号或点号。这是为了安全考虑,以防止密码被偷窥。

    5. 接受指纹信息(只在第一次登录时出现):第一次登录服务器时,会收到一个询问是否接受指纹信息的提示。这是为了确保你连接到了正确的服务器。按照提示,输入"yes"表示接受指纹信息并继续连接。

      接受指纹信息后,SSH会将服务器的指纹信息存储在本地,以便以后再次连接时进行验证。

    6. 连接成功:如果一切顺利,你将成功连接到Linux服务器。你将会看到一个终端或命令提示符,表示你已经登录到服务器。现在可以通过输入命令来操作服务器。

    登录成功后,你可以执行各种操作,如查看文件、修改配置、安装软件等。注意,登录Linux服务器需要有相应的用户名和密码。如果你忘记了密码,你可能需要联系系统管理员进行密码重置。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部